石 楓
(西安職業(yè)技術(shù)學(xué)院 陜西 西安 710077)
在車(chē)削加工過(guò)程中,為了提高效率及保證質(zhì)量,經(jīng)常使用一些正前角成形車(chē)刀,帶正前角的車(chē)刀切削性能較好。 但是,由于成形車(chē)刀帶有正前角。 如果直接按工件廓形設(shè)計(jì)刀具廓形,加工出來(lái)的工件形狀將發(fā)生畸變,造成工件超差,所以,必須對(duì)刀具廓形進(jìn)行修正。 但是,采取傳統(tǒng)的修正方法很是麻煩,不能滿(mǎn)足快節(jié)奏的產(chǎn)品更新。 因此,我們采取計(jì)算機(jī)輔助的參數(shù)化設(shè)計(jì)。 現(xiàn)在以下的內(nèi)容里進(jìn)行介紹。
成型車(chē)刀常用的方法有兩種,一種是作圖法,另一種是計(jì)算法。 在這里我們主要研究計(jì)算法。 如果我們要用成型車(chē)刀加工一個(gè)軸類(lèi)零件,其具體外觀(guān)如圖(1)。
由圖(1)可以看出,這個(gè)工件的廓形是一個(gè)既有圓弧又有直線(xiàn)的形狀。 關(guān)于車(chē)刀的廓形設(shè)計(jì)可以參照?qǐng)D(2)進(jìn)行計(jì)算。
圖(1)
圖(2)
成形車(chē)刀各刃點(diǎn)廓形深度的計(jì)算方法:
我們根據(jù)圖(2)的關(guān)系可以看出,p2,p3,p4 可以求出,即就1,2,3,4,點(diǎn)的廓形深度可以求出。 其計(jì)算如下:
①h=r1xsinγ
②A1=r1*cosγf
③Sinγf2=h/r2
④A2=r2xcosγf2
⑤C2=A2-A1
⑥P2=C2xcos(γf+αf)
⑦Sinγf3=h/r3
⑧A2=r2xcosγf3
⑨C3=A3-A1
⑩P3=C3xcos(γf+αf)
計(jì)算機(jī)輔助成型車(chē)刀的修正有以下3 個(gè)步驟
①以過(guò)點(diǎn)1 垂直工件中心線(xiàn)的直線(xiàn)與工件中心線(xiàn)的交點(diǎn)為圓點(diǎn)x,y 軸方向不變建立坐標(biāo)系, 則有點(diǎn)坐標(biāo)(x1,y1),(x2,y2),(x3,y3),(x4,y4)。 其中,x1=l1,x2=l2,x3=l3,x4=l4,r1=y1,r2=y2,r3=y3,r4=y4,x1,x2,x3,x4,r1,r2,r3,r4 都直接或間接已知。
②用成型車(chē)刀廓形深度計(jì)算公式求出p1,p2,p3,p4 的值。 組成點(diǎn)(x1,p1),(x2,p2),(x3,p3),(x4,p4)點(diǎn)。
③以3 點(diǎn)(x1,p1),(x2,p2),(x3,p3)作圓弧,以(x3,p3),(x4,p4)作直線(xiàn),則由點(diǎn)(x1,p1),(x2,p2),(x3,p3),(x4,p4)形成的曲線(xiàn)即就是修正后的成型車(chē)刀廓形。
我們常加工的零件廓形一般包括圓弧、直線(xiàn)、直線(xiàn)和圓弧的組合。 直線(xiàn)修正以后的刀具廓形仍是直線(xiàn),圓弧修正后所形成的曲線(xiàn),采用圓弧代替。
2.2.1 選用最常用的嵌套在autocad R14 中的autolisp 語(yǔ)言進(jìn)行編程
①首先,輸入在工件廓形上選擇的點(diǎn)。程序中使用get 類(lèi)輸入函數(shù)進(jìn)行輸入。 表達(dá)為:
(setq P1 (getpoint))
(setq P2 (getpoint))…
②使用表處理函數(shù)提取所獲得點(diǎn)的坐標(biāo)值,并把所得的值賦給l1,l2,r1,r2 等。
因?yàn)?,兩維坐標(biāo)是一個(gè)簡(jiǎn)單的表所以在程序中表達(dá)為:
(setq l1(car(P1))
(setq r1 (cadr(P1))
(setq l2 (car (P2)
(setq r2 (cadr(p2))…
③使用計(jì)算函數(shù)求出p1,p2 等的值
只需把前面所用的公式轉(zhuǎn)化成autolisp 表達(dá)格式就可以了。 由這些公式可以得到p1,p2…的值
④使用構(gòu)造表的函數(shù)構(gòu)造修正后車(chē)刀廓形上的點(diǎn)P11,P22 等
(setq P11 (list l1 p1)
(setq P22 (list l2 p2)
…
⑤調(diào)用autocad 的command 命令進(jìn)行繪圖。
(command “circle“ ”3P“ P11 P22 P33)
(command “l(fā)ine“ P33 P44 ”“)
通過(guò)上面的繪圖命令即可畫(huà)出,修正后成型車(chē)刀的廓形曲線(xiàn)。
⑥使用標(biāo)注命令進(jìn)行標(biāo)注
(command “dim“ ”rad“ P22 ” “ ”exit“)
(command “hor“ P11 P44 )
⑦在程序最前面把整個(gè)程序定義為一個(gè)函數(shù)
defun cxcdsj ()
2.2.2 程序的使用
使用時(shí)只須在autocad 的命令行輸入
command :
(load “cxcdsj.lsp”)↘
command :cxcdsj↘
然后,根據(jù)命令行要求輸入數(shù)值,則運(yùn)行結(jié)果如圖(3),即就是修正后的刀具刃的輪廓。
圖(3)
由于使用參數(shù)化繪圖,使原本很復(fù)雜的過(guò)程變的很簡(jiǎn)單,減輕了設(shè)計(jì)人員的強(qiáng)度,提高了設(shè)計(jì)的效率,值得推廣。
[1]袁哲俊.金屬切削刀具[M].2 版.上??萍汲霭嫔?,1993.
[2]梁雪春,等.autoLISP 實(shí)用教程[M].人民郵電出版社,1998.
[3]孫全平,葉偉昌.圓體成形車(chē)刀廓形的計(jì)算機(jī)輔助設(shè)計(jì)[J].淮陰工學(xué)院學(xué)報(bào),1995(02).
[4]梁潔萍.成形車(chē)刀廓形的計(jì)算機(jī)輔助設(shè)計(jì)[J].湖南理工學(xué)院學(xué)報(bào):自然科學(xué)版,2000(02).
[5]王有遠(yuǎn).棱體成形車(chē)刀的計(jì)算機(jī)輔助設(shè)計(jì)[J].工具技術(shù),2001,12.
[6]張志梅,安虎平.成形刀設(shè)計(jì)算法及其刃形修正的基本原則[J].大眾科技,2011(06).